#Rio2016 - Antimicrobial suits could be an answer to Rio 2016's pollution issues. But are they all they're cracked up to be?

Headlines have made much of the microbe-resistant properties of the new costumes designed for the US Olympic rowing team, as Ars Technica reports.

Comprising two layers, one to wick water from the skin and the other with an antimicrobial finish, the fabric is being talked up for its properties of protection against the water-borne pathogens in Guanabara Bay and the Rodrigo de Freitas lagoon – the latter where rowers will compete next month.

But the textile engineer behind the design says any such claims are "overblown".

Speaking to Vocativ, Mark Sunderland of Philadelphia University confirmed that the antimicrobial finish was an "afterthought" and comparable to athletic wear already on the high street.

Indeed, the primary benefit to rowers is the suit's seamless fit, covering less than half of the body – designed for comfort in high-performance conditions, not for health reasons.

#Rio2016 - Olympics organisers in Rio have a new headache alongside Zika concerns and rising crime – the city's sailing waters are turning boats brown.



After Chilean 49erFX squad Team Gumucio posted the above video to Facebook, further reports have emerged of sailors getting caught in an oil slick on Guanabara Bay.

"We've never seen anything like this. It was all over the place," Finnish sailor Camilla Cedercreutz told the Associated Press after the slick stained the white hull of her boat brown.

It appears sailors training in Rio's waters ahead of next month's Games now have to add industrial pollution to their list of issues with the Olympic aquatic venue on top of floating debris and high levels of pathogens.

#Fishing - 'Money for old rope' is the pitch for a new initiative that aims to recycle old fishing nets that often end up littering the seas, as the Irish Examiner reports.

A number of Irish companies have been invited to Norway later this year to explore the possibility of collecting abandoned fishing nets and other ocean waste for repurposing in various industries – such as using the rope fibres in reinforced concrete.

They will be led by Macroom E, a company started by Cork County Council to help small and medium businesses make the most of recycling initiatives.

Macroom E is a partner with Circular Ocean, a Europe-wide project hosting a showcase this September on its work to remove waste from the ocean – where plastic and 'ghost nets' remain a hazard to marine wildlife – and turn it into a useful, and profitable, resource.

#Larne - Coastal wildlife in Co Antrim is under threat after a significant diesel spill from a Caterpillar plant in Larne at the weekend, as the News Letter reports.

The plant machinery firm faces likely enforcement action after 40,000 litres of red diesel leaked into Larne Lough via a storm drain – news of which was not made public till days later, according to the Belfast Telegraph.

As the Northern Ireland Environment Agency moved to assure that the spill's impact on marine life would be minimal, conservationists remain concerned as the diesel slick was seen drifting towards The Gobbins, home to many protected seabird species.

Spot checks of affected parts of the Antrim coast have as yet found no injured birds, but Ulster Wildlife maintains that the spill "could have potentially devastating impacts on breeding birds".

#Pollution - Inland Fisheries Ireland (IFI) has issued an appeal to all farmers to be vigilant when harvesting silage and spreading slurry to avoid water pollution.

Silage operations are ongoing all summer and silage effluent has the potential to cause devastating pollution in streams and rivers. Silage effluent is one of the most polluting substances to threaten the environment and can cause massive fish kills if it enters a watercourse.

Slurry spread on grassland over the summer months can also wipe out fish and invertebrate life if allowed to enter a stream. Water levels in streams and rivers are low in the summer months and have less dilution capacity, so are particularly vulnerable to pollution at this time.

“The fisheries service is appealing to all farmers and contractors to be careful that no silage effluent is allowed to run off into drains or watercourses," said Dr Greg Forde, head of operations at IFI.

"Round bales are the most environmentally friendly way to store silage. However, if a silage pit is used, it must be properly lined to prevent leakage.

“Good farmyard management will help to prevent accidental run-off and protect the local environment. Slurry spreading should only be carried out in dry weather, and not when heavy rain is forecast. It should never be spread close to a watercourse, and tanks should never be cleaned beside a stream or river.

Dr Forde addd that IFI “is grateful to the farming community for its co-operation at this busy time of year, and for its assistance in maintaining a clean and healthy environment in our lakes and rivers.”

At a sitting of Cavan District Court on 21st April 2016, Judge Denis McLaughlin convicted Irish Water in relation to a pollution incident arising from the wastewater treatment plant at Ballinagh, Co. Cavan.

Senior fisheries environmental officer Ailish Keane from Inland Fisheries Ireland (IFI) gave evidence that she had written to Irish Water on several occasions prior to the incident about failings at the treatment plant, but the company had not acted. On 20th June 2015, IFI staff noticed effluent entering the Ballinagh River and Ms Keane attended the scene and took samples. The samples showed very serious pollution of the river coming from the treatment plant, with levels of some pollutants almost 600 times higher than upstream.

In particular, the level of ammonia observed downstream was 17.9 milligrams per litre – 597 times the level of 0.03 milligrams per litre measured upstream, a level recognised as clean salmonid water. The level of suspended solids was 122 milligrams per litre, approximately 3.5 times higher than the plant’s allowed emission limit. The biological oxygen demand, a measure of bacterial growth in the water, was measured at 223.8 milligrams per litre downstream which is 45 times higher than what is expected in clean unpolluted water, and over 100 times higher than the level of two milligrams per litre observed upstream.

Judge Denis McLaughlin refused to consider a plea by defence counsel to consider a donation to charity, insisting that the delay in rectifying the issue by Irish Water, and the serious level of pollution, merited a conviction. He convicted and fined the company €2,500 in addition to costs amounting to €3,917.43.

#MarineWildlife - Toxic chemicals banned in Europe nearly 30 years ago are still polluting the seas off the continent.

And marine scientists fear their continued presence could spell the end for the killer whale and other species in European waters, as the Irish Examiner reports.

The warning comes from newly published research on concentrations of polychlorinated biphenyls, or PCBs, in marine wildlife – specifically orcas and other dolphins – in Irish, British and Mediterranean waters.

Co-authored by Dr Simon Berrow of GMIT and the Irish Whale and Dolphin Group, the paper in the latest issue of journal Scientific Reports claims that despite the outright ban on the use of PCBs since 1987, they persist in "dangerously high levels in European cetaceans".

High exposure to PCBs, once used in the manufacture of paints and electrical equipment, weakens the immune systems of cetaceans and has a severe effect on their breeding rates.

Changing Ocean Climate

Our ocean and climate are inextricably linked - the ocean plays a crucial role in the global climate system in a number of ways. These include absorbing excess heat from the atmosphere and absorbing 30 per cent of the carbon dioxide added to the atmosphere by human activity. But our marine ecosystems are coming under increasing pressure due to climate change.

The Marine Institute, with its national and international partners, works to observe and understand how our ocean is changing and analyses, models and projects the impacts of our changing oceans. Advice and forecasting projections of our changing oceans and climate are essential to create effective policies and management decisions to safeguard our ocean.

Dr Paul Connolly, CEO of the Marine Institute, said, “Our ocean is fundamental to life on earth and affects so many facets of our everyday activities. One of the greatest challenges we face as a society is that of our changing climate. The strong international collaborations that the Marine Institute has built up over decades facilitates a shared focusing on our changing ocean climate and developing new and enhanced ways of monitoring it and tracking changes over time.

“Our knowledge and services help us to observe these patterns of change and identify the steps to safeguard our marine ecosystems for future generations.”

The Marine Institute’s annual ocean climate research survey, which has been running since 2004, facilitates long term monitoring of the deep water environment to the west of Ireland. This repeat survey, which takes place on board RV Celtic Explorer, enables scientists to establish baseline oceanic conditions in Irish waters that can be used as a benchmark for future changes.

Scientists collect data on temperature, salinity, water currents, oxygen and carbon dioxide in the Atlantic Ocean. This high quality oceanographic data contributes to the Atlantic Ocean Observing System. Physical oceanographic data from the survey is submitted to the International Council for the Exploration of the Seas (ICES) and, in addition, the survey contributes to national research such as the VOCAB ocean acidification and biogeochemistry project, the ‘Clean Atlantic’ project on marine litter and the A4 marine climate change project.

Dr Caroline Cusack, who co-ordinates scientific activities on board the RV Celtic Explorer for the annual survey, said, “The generation of long-term series to monitor ocean climate is vital to allow us understand the likely impact of future changes in ocean climate on ecosystems and other marine resources.”

Other activities during the survey in 2019 included the deployment of oceanographic gliders, two Argo floats (Ireland’s contribution to EuroArgo) and four surface drifters (Interreg Atlantic Area Clean Atlantic project). The new Argo floats have the capacity to measure dissolved ocean and biogeochemical parameters from the ocean surface down to a depth of 2,000 metres continuously for up to four years, providing important information as to the health of our oceans.

During the 2019 survey, the RV Celtic Explorer retrieved a string of oceanographic sensors from the deep ocean at an adjacent subsurface moored station and deployed a replacement M6 weather buoy, as part of the Irish Marine Data Buoy Observation Network (IMDBON).

Funded by the Department of Agriculture, Food and the Marine, the IMDBON is managed by the Marine Institute in collaboration with Met Éireann and is designed to improve weather forecasts and safety at sea around Ireland. The data buoys have instruments which collect weather and ocean data including wind speed and direction, pressure, air and sea surface temperature and wave statistics. This data provides vital information for weather forecasts, shipping bulletins, gale and swell warnings as well as data for general public information and research.

“It is only in the last 20 years, meteorologists and climatologists have really began to understood the pivotal role the ocean plays in determining our climate and weather,” said Evelyn Cusack, Head of Forecasting at Met Éireann. “The real-time information provided by the Irish data buoy network is particularly important for our mariners and rescue services. The M6 data buoy in the Atlantic provides vital information on swell waves generated by Atlantic storms. Even though the weather and winds may be calm around our shores, there could be some very high swells coming in from Atlantic storms.”
